What Influences iCarSe Loan Interest Rates?
Alright, let’s get down to the nitty-gritty. Several factors play a role in determining iCarSe loan interest rates in Thailand. Think of it like a recipe – the interest rate is the final dish, and each ingredient contributes to its flavor. First up, we have the overall economic climate. When the economy is booming, interest rates might be higher because banks are more confident in lending money. Conversely, during a downturn, rates might be lower to encourage borrowing and stimulate the economy. Then, there's the benchmark interest rate set by the Bank of Thailand. This acts as a foundation, influencing the rates offered by all banks and financial institutions. Lenders will often base their rates on this benchmark, adding their own margins on top. Another critical factor is your creditworthiness. Just like when you apply for a credit card, the better your credit score, the lower the interest rate you'll likely receive. Banks assess your ability to repay the loan based on your credit history, income, and other financial commitments. They see a lower risk with borrowers who have a good track record, which translates into more favorable interest rates. The type of car you're buying can also influence the rate. Newer cars, or those from reputable brands, might qualify for better rates than older models or less-known brands. This is because newer cars are often seen as less of a risk due to their reliability and potential resale value. Next, consider the loan terms. Longer loan terms, like five or seven years, might come with slightly higher interest rates than shorter terms. This is because the longer the loan duration, the more the bank is exposed to risk. Moreover, the down payment you make also matters. A larger down payment can often help you secure a lower interest rate, as it reduces the amount the bank needs to lend and minimizes their risk. Banks often offer attractive rates to customers who can provide a significant upfront payment. Remember, the competition among lenders is fierce. Always compare offers from different banks and financial institutions to find the best deals. Don't be afraid to shop around and negotiate. The more informed you are, the better your chances of getting a favorable rate. Let's delve into how you can practically apply these insights.
Finding the Best iCarSe Loan Deals in Thailand
Alright, folks, now that we know what influences the rates, let’s talk about how to find the best iCarSe loan deals in Thailand. It's like a treasure hunt, and your goal is to find the hidden gems with the most favorable terms. First and foremost, do your research. Start by visiting the websites of various banks and financial institutions that offer car loans in Thailand. Compare their interest rates, loan terms, and any associated fees. Most lenders have detailed information online, so you can gather a lot of data from the comfort of your home. Use online comparison tools. There are several websites that allow you to compare car loan offers from different lenders side-by-side. These tools are a great way to quickly assess your options and identify the most competitive rates. Don't just focus on the interest rate alone, look at the annual percentage rate (APR). This includes not just the interest rate, but also other fees associated with the loan, such as processing fees and insurance costs. The APR gives you a more accurate picture of the total cost of the loan. Contact multiple lenders. Once you've done your online research, contact several banks and financial institutions directly. Ask them for quotes and details about their loan products. This allows you to ask specific questions and negotiate terms that suit your needs. Remember, the first offer isn't always the best offer. Negotiate! This is a crucial step. Don't be afraid to negotiate the interest rate or other terms of the loan. Let lenders know that you're comparing offers and see if they are willing to lower their rates to win your business. This is where your research pays off because you'll know what a good deal looks like. Consider a secured loan. A secured car loan requires you to use the car itself as collateral. This typically means lower interest rates because the lender has a safety net if you default on the loan. Of course, there are some risks involved, but it's something to consider. Work with a car broker. Car brokers often have relationships with multiple lenders and can help you find the best loan deals. They can also assist with the loan application process, saving you time and effort. Check for promotions and special offers. Banks frequently run promotions and offer special rates on car loans. Keep an eye out for these promotions, as they can save you a significant amount of money. Some offers might include lower interest rates, waived fees, or other benefits. Evaluate all the costs. Besides the interest rate, be sure to consider all the associated costs, such as loan origination fees, early repayment penalties, and insurance premiums. These additional costs can significantly impact the overall cost of the loan. Getting the best deal requires patience, research, and negotiation skills. By following these steps, you’ll increase your chances of securing a favorable iCarSe loan.
Tips for Navigating iCarSe Loan Application in Thailand
Okay, you've done your homework, found some promising iCarSe loan deals, and now it's time to apply. Applying for a car loan can seem a little daunting, but with the right preparation, you can navigate the process smoothly. First things first, gather all necessary documents. This usually includes your ID card, proof of income, and proof of residence. Your income can be demonstrated via your employment letter and also your bank statements. The lender will need to assess your financial stability, so having all the required documents ready will speed up the application process. Check your credit report. Before applying, review your credit report to ensure there are no errors or discrepancies. A clean credit report significantly increases your chances of getting approved for a loan and securing a favorable interest rate. Fix any errors before submitting your application. Understand the loan terms. Carefully read and understand all the loan terms and conditions before signing anything. Pay close attention to the interest rate, repayment schedule, and any associated fees or penalties. If anything is unclear, don't hesitate to ask the lender for clarification. Prepare a detailed budget. Calculate your monthly income and expenses to determine how much you can comfortably afford to pay each month. This will help you select a loan amount and repayment term that fits your financial situation. Avoid applying for multiple loans at once. Applying for too many loans at the same time can negatively impact your credit score. If you need to shop around for the best rates, spread out your applications over a period of time. Pay attention to the loan-to-value (LTV) ratio. The LTV ratio is the loan amount divided by the value of the car. A lower LTV ratio often results in a lower interest rate, as the lender is taking on less risk. Make a larger down payment if possible to reduce the LTV. Consider a co-signer. If your credit score is not ideal or your income is relatively low, consider having a co-signer with a good credit history and stable income. This can increase your chances of loan approval and potentially secure a lower interest rate. Ask about pre-approval. Get pre-approved for a loan before you start shopping for a car. Pre-approval will give you an idea of how much you can borrow and what interest rate you can expect. This will also give you an advantage when negotiating with the car dealer. Be honest in your application. Provide accurate and complete information in your loan application. Lying or omitting information can lead to rejection or even legal consequences. Keep records of all communications. Keep copies of all documents and communications with the lender. This will be helpful if you have any questions or disputes in the future. Don't rush the process. Take your time to review all the terms and conditions and ask any questions you have. Rushing into a loan can lead to costly mistakes. Comparing iCarSe Loans: Key Factors to Consider
Alright, you're at the point where you're comparing iCarSe loans and trying to decide which one is right for you. It's like comparing apples and oranges – you need to look at several factors to make an informed decision. The first factor to consider is the interest rate. This is the most crucial factor, of course. Compare the interest rates offered by different lenders. Be sure to check the annual percentage rate (APR), which includes the interest rate and other fees. The loan term is also important. This is the length of time you have to repay the loan. Longer loan terms result in lower monthly payments, but you'll pay more interest over the life of the loan. Shorter loan terms mean higher monthly payments, but you'll pay less interest overall. The monthly payment is another critical factor. Determine how much you can comfortably afford to pay each month. Make sure the monthly payment fits within your budget, considering all your other expenses. Consider the total cost of the loan. This is the total amount you will pay over the life of the loan, including the principal, interest, and any fees. This includes all the costs associated with the loan. This gives you a clear picture of the overall expense of the loan. Also, examine the fees and charges associated with the loan. Many loans include various fees, such as loan origination fees, processing fees, and early repayment penalties. Be sure to understand all the fees before you commit to a loan. Look into the repayment flexibility. Does the loan offer any flexibility in terms of repayment, such as the option to make extra payments or change your repayment schedule? Consider your credit score requirements. What is the minimum credit score required to qualify for the loan? Make sure your credit score meets the lender's requirements. Analyze the loan features. Does the loan offer any special features, such as the ability to refinance the loan or make automatic payments? Also, what are the lender's reputation and customer service like? Read reviews and check the lender's reputation for customer service. Choosing the right iCarSe loan requires careful consideration. By comparing all these factors, you can make an informed decision and find the loan that best suits your needs and financial situation.
